Key Areas of Overlap and Divergence
This section identifies specific policy areas where Kennedy’s platform aligns with or contrasts with Project 2025’s goals. The analysis focuses on key issues likely to shape the 2024 election.
Policy Area | RFK Jr.’s Stance | Project 2025 Goals | Analysis of Alignment |
---|---|---|---|
Foreign Policy | Emphasis on diplomacy, reduced military intervention, and reassessment of foreign alliances. | Prioritizes a strong national defense, assertive foreign policy, and selective engagement in global affairs. | Partial alignment: Both advocate for a strong national defense, but differ significantly on the approach to international relations. RFK Jr.’s emphasis on diplomacy contrasts with Project 2025’s more interventionist stance. |
Economic Policy | Focus on addressing income inequality, promoting fair trade, and regulating corporate power. | Advocates for lower taxes, reduced regulation, and free market principles. | Significant divergence: RFK Jr.’s platform prioritizes government intervention to address economic inequality, directly opposing Project 2025’s emphasis on deregulation and free market solutions. |
Healthcare | Supports universal healthcare access, pharmaceutical price controls, and addressing the opioid crisis. | Emphasizes market-based healthcare solutions, emphasizing individual choice and competition. | Significant divergence: These positions represent fundamentally different approaches to healthcare, with RFK Jr. favoring government-led solutions and Project 2025 advocating for market-driven reforms. |
Immigration | Advocates for comprehensive immigration reform, addressing the root causes of migration, and securing the border. | Supports stricter border security measures and a more restrictive immigration policy. | Partial alignment: Both acknowledge the need for border security, but differ significantly on approaches to immigration reform and the treatment of undocumented immigrants. |

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s Official Position on Project 2025
Robert F. Kennedy Jr. has not explicitly endorsed or condemned Project 2025 in a formal statement. His campaign platform touches upon several areas relevant to Project 2025’s goals, such as energy independence and economic policy, but a direct, definitive statement regarding his support or opposition remains absent from his official campaign materials. Analysis of his speeches and interviews reveals a focus on issues that overlap with some of Project 2025’s aims, but a clear alignment or rejection is lacking. This ambiguity leaves room for interpretation and fuels ongoing discussion.
